Internationalization

Analyse how well each language or country version of your site reaches its intended audience.

Using country-by-page data, the report runs in two modes: Folder (locales within one property, such as /de/ subdirectories or de. subdomains) and Domain (comparing multiple ccTLD properties).

What you get

  • Three tabs: Country Targeting, Cannibalization (the wrong locale or domain capturing a country’s traffic), and Cross-Property Comparison.
  • A per-site setting that decides whether a folder like /ar/ means a country or a language.
  • Exportable tables.

Hreflang tags tell Google which language/country version to serve; misalignment sends users to the wrong one. See the FAQ on hreflang.
